Intro to Business
Intro to Business introduces business concepts and skills students need in today’s competitive environment. Classroom discussion will cover major business concepts, such as finance, marketing, operations, and management. Students gain valuable information and skills for the workplace, as well as preparation for success in competitive events.

General Business
General Business expands on business concepts and skills learned in Intro to Business. Classroom discussion will cover major business concepts, such as investing, insurance, taxes, and career. Students gain valuable information and skills for the workplace, as well as preparation for success in competitive events.
